The fourth Game Boy Crayon Shin-Chan game. Like Telefang, it was more widely known by the bootleg hack Super Mario 4.

Test Mode

Crayon Shin-chan 4- Ora no Itazura Daihenshin Test Mode.png

Enter かみしばい in the password screen to enter test mode.

From top to bottom, the options translate to the following:

Debug Menu

Enable Game Genie code 003‑57B‑F7A and start a new game to enter the Debug menu instead. Allows you to play any level from the beginning or from the midpoint, select amount of lives, items to carry, as well as to enable invulnerability. Also you can listen to all music and game sounds.

Note, there are no numbers displayed because of lack of the proper font in the title screen CHR data, however they are selectable by pressing Left/Right anyway.

Also note that this code doesn't work properly in Super Mario 4 due to the lack of main menu cause it to hang on the title screen.
